The meeting for picking the ODI and T20 team for the upcoming series against England started on Friday, after the Lodha panel gave nod to conduct the selection process, in Mumbai.
As per the Supreme Court orders, no BCCI office-bearers took part of the meeting.
The meeting is crucial as the BCCI has to name the captain for the England series as M.S. Dhoni stepped down two days back.
It is likely that the selection committee, led by MSK Prasad, will appoint Virat Kohli as the captain for all the three formats.
Earlier, the Lodha panel said that since Amitabh Chaudhary is no longer the joint secretary, he cannot convene the BCCI’s selection committee meeting.
The BCCI continued to show defiance despite a clear verdict from the Supreme Court and needed a written directive from the Lodha Panel to go ahead with its selection committee meeting, which was delayed by three hours on technical grounds.
